About the Job
The Field Technician performs on-site or in-house servicing, repair and/or installation of customer equipment. This job may include any aspect of field support including: troubleshooting and repair of electronic equipment, systems, and wiring; installation of equipment; upgrades, modifications, programming; preventive maintenance actions; and documentation.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following: Other duties may be assigned:
Installation, preventive and corrective maintenance of equipment to include PC based computers, video surveillance equipment, network communications equipment, and/or radio equipment.
Completes reports, logs and performs shift-to-shift communications in accordance with established policies, procedures and local practices.
Responds to corrective maintenance requests or alarms within an acceptable time frame.
Diagnoses and repairs hardware, software, and system issues
Reports technical status of system with accuracy and completeness.
Restores equipment to operational status as quickly as possible.
Maintenance of spare equipment and parts following guidelines set forth to do so.
Module or PC Board swap out
Isolation of faults in units or components
Field test of units or components
Electronic filing of work orders
Assists with the training of less experienced technicians.
Education :
High school diploma or general education degree (GED) required. One year certificate from college or technical school preferred.
